What is a Road Sweeper PTO Shaft used for?
A Road Sweeper PTO Shaft is used to transfer mechanical power from a vehicle's power take-off (PTO) to the sweeper attachment, enabling the brushes or vacuum system to operate efficiently for cleaning roads and other surfaces.
How do I choose the right PTO shaft for my sweeper?
To choose the right PTO shaft, consider factors such as the torque requirements of your sweeper, the distance between the PTO and the sweeper input, the operating speed, and the type of spline connection (e.g., 6-spline or 21-spline). Always refer to your sweeper's manual or consult with a technician for compatibility.
What maintenance does the PTO shaft require?
Regular maintenance includes checking for wear on the universal joints, lubricating the bearings every 50 hours of operation, inspecting for cracks or corrosion, and ensuring all bolts are tight. Proper maintenance extends the shaft's lifespan and prevents failures.

How long does a typical Road Sweeper PTO Shaft last?
With proper use and maintenance, a typical shaft can last between 3 to 5 years, depending on the operating conditions, frequency of use, and adherence to maintenance schedules. Harsh environments may reduce this lifespan.
Is installation complicated?
Installation is straightforward for experienced users; it involves attaching the shaft to the PTO output and the sweeper input, ensuring proper alignment and securing with pins or bolts. However, if unsure, it's recommended to seek professional assistance to avoid misalignment issues.
